Play Framework/Scala example source code file (SqlStatementParser.scala)
The SqlStatementParser.scala Play Framework example source code/* * Copyright (C) 2009-2013 Typesafe Inc. <http://www.typesafe.com> */ package anorm import scala.language.postfixOps import scala.util.parsing.combinator._ /** Parser for SQL statement. */ object SqlStatementParser extends JavaTokenParsers { /** * Returns updated statement and associated parameter names. * Extracts parameter names from {placeholder}s, replaces with ?. * * {{{ * import anorm.SqlStatementParser.parse * * val parsed: (String, List[String]) = * parse("SELECT * FROM schema.table WHERE name = {name} AND cat = ?") * // parsed == * // ("SELECT * FROM schema.table WHERE name = ?
